首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>mysql memcached

mysql memcached
EN

Stack Overflow用户
提问于 2015-06-17 10:30:38
回答 1查看 353关注 0票数 1

我对mysql memcached有一些疑问,例如:

1。mysql缓存和memcached之间的主要区别是什么?我主要想问,在这两种缓存中都采用了哪些缓存技术?

2 .What是在mysql缓存上使用memcached的好处,而且memcached在mysql缓存上提供了哪些附加功能??

3 .Can,我在现有的java应用程序中使用memcached,而不对现有的JDBC代码进行任何修改,如果没有,我需要在JDBC代码中进行哪些必要的修改。??请举例说明我如何做到这一点。

4。使用memcached频繁更新表好吗?

5。我想在我的java应用程序中使用memcached,但是我找不到相关的示例,所以请给我一些示例,说明我如何使用它??

我已经在网上搜索过答案,但是找不到相关的例子。因此,请提供详细的解释和一些例子的答案。感谢你的期待。

EN

回答 1

Stack Overflow用户

发布于 2015-06-17 13:34:30

  1. 根据使用的引擎的不同,MySQL的性能通常会优于memcached在链接处找到的推理和扩展解释
  2. 可能没有,如果有的话,你很可能最终会浪费内存,却没有什么大的好处。连接到memcached没有理由比连接到MySQL所承受的压力更小--两者都应该同样快/慢,而且许多语言和框架实现连接池,以便在已建立的MySQL连接上为并发请求提供服务,因此避免了由于连接到MySQL而造成的性能损失。
  3. 不适用
  4. 如何将memcached用于频繁更新的表?数据必须写入磁盘,memcached将如何帮助那里?MySQL的缓存比memcached快,所以在这个场景中,memcached完全没有帮助您。
  5. 不适用

我没有提到第3点和第5点,因为网络上到处都是可搜索的例子。

长话短说,如果您正确地使用了(适当的专用服务器,具有适当的InnoDB / TokuDB配置,使用准备好的语句来减轻频繁查询上的SQL ),那么就不需要使用memcached和MySQL。

票数 1
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/30888941

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档